The cause of Priest-Kings had been advanced; the restoration of Marlenus to the throne of Ar had been accomplished.
But beyond this there was little in which I could rejoice.
"Please," said Hup.
"Accompany me to the court of my Ubar".
I looked down at him and smiled.
"Very well, Small Friend," said I.
We began the long journey through the halls of Ar's great Central Cylinder, almost a city in itself.
- (Assassin of Gor, Chapter 24)
